Transaction 26a040366f2b641744ee63a586903bb8ecb6eb3bc5099c60193f0ff6a215cbf7

1 Input
2 Outputs
  • 26a040366f2b641744ee63a586903bb8ecb6eb3bc5099c60193f0ff6a215cbf7:0
  • value  2000000
    address  33jJMRyzAbcHttpqFBYTH1BdkFZpag21Jc
  • 26a040366f2b641744ee63a586903bb8ecb6eb3bc5099c60193f0ff6a215cbf7:1
  • value  98251639
    address  1FaRf9THwPBEdzRmwWMoawXNCbSbAdDK88